Average Retail Salespersons Salary in Southwest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
Retail Salespersons in the Southwest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area earn an average annual salary of $32,130. This figure is notably below the national average of $37,150, reflecting regional economic factors and potentially a different market dynamic for retail roles in this specific locale. The lower average salary is often a consequence of localized demand and the economic structure of nonmetropolitan regions.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 1,230 employees in the Southwest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area area with a job density of 19.771 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
